(TIC) Trauma Informed Care TRAINING 

Training is aimed at all staff working with children who have experience trauma in Child Welfare, Out of Home Care, Child Protection, Residential, Respite or School settings. In this workshop the following will be covered: trauma & attachment informed practice, impact of trauma & attachment, intervention, support & managing personal stress.  Workshop will also involve practice scenarios which will enable participants to learn and work through the issues better. Workshop is inline with Child Youth & Family Services model for therapeutic & trauma informed care.

Course Content

  • Types of Trauma
  • The Impact of Trauma & Attachment
  • What does Child Trauma & Attachment look like
  • Neurobiology of Trauma
  • Trauma & Attachment Informed Practice
  • Intervention Strategies for Children with Trauma
  • Providing Support to the Child
  • Managing Professional & Personal Stress

Learning Outcomes

  • Provide information about concepts associated with trauma informed care as they relate to child welfare & behavioral health settings
  • Gain increased understanding of the implications of trauma for case planning and intervention
  • Identifying providers who practice in trauma informed ways.
  • Provide examples of specific indicators of trauma & attachment informed child welfare practices.
